Conserve energy. Conserve it at home, at work, everywhere.



2

Car pool or use public transportation. When air quality is healthy, bike or walk instead of driving.



3

Combine errands to reduce vehicle trips. Think ahead and save yourself both time and fuel costs, as well as sparing air quality from decreasing some more.



4

Limit engine idling. Idling adds more smog-inducing particles to the atmosphere. Avoid it unless absolutely essential for human health (such as keeping warm in freezing weather).



5

Refuel with care. How you refuel has an impact on air quality. To reduce this impact, consider the following steps:



Stop when the pump shuts off. Putting more fuel in is bad for the environment and can damage your vehicle.

Avoid spilling fuel.

Always tighten your gas cap securely.



6

Keep your car, boat, and other engines tuned up. Inflate your car’s tires to the recommended pressure. This will produce the best performance for your car and reduces fuel usage.



7

Use environmentally safe paints and cleaning products whenever possible. Such paints and cleaning products emit less smog-producing particles to the air and are better for your breathing health too.



8

Follow manufacturers’ recommendations to use and properly seal cleaners, paints, and other chemicals. Carefully following the instructions ensures that smog-forming chemicals can’t evaporate.

Electrostatic precipitators reduce industrial air pollution by ionizing pollutant particles, collecting them on oppositely charged electrodes and removing them. Cyclone separators rotate air forcefully to hurl impurities against its side walls, and scrubbers have water sprays that remove impurities as air passes through. The government regulates automotive air pollution by requiring the installation of antipollution devices, such as the catalytic converter, in cars and trucks. It's possible to prevent home air pollution by adding electrostatic precipitators or mechanical filters to air conditioners. Here, they filter dander, dust, smoke and other pollutants. Portable air cleaners, forced-air furnaces and air purifiers also use filters to remove pollutants from small, enclosed areas.
